Aurangpur Population - Aurangabad, Maharashtra

Aurangpur is a small village located in Vaijapur Taluka of Aurangabad district, Maharashtra with total 31 families residing. The Aurangpur village has population of 156 of which 86 are males while 70 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Aurangpur village population of children with age 0-6 is 18 which makes up 11.54 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Aurangpur village is 814 which is lower than Maharashtra state average of 929. Child Sex Ratio for the Aurangpur as per census is 636, lower than Maharashtra average of 894.

Aurangpur village has lower literacy rate compared to Maharashtra. In 2011, literacy rate of Aurangpur village was 71.74 % compared to 82.34 % of Maharashtra. In Aurangpur Male literacy stands at 81.33 % while female literacy rate was 60.32 %.

Caste Factor

There is no population of Schedule Caste (SC) and Schedule Tribe(ST) in Aurangpur village of Aurangabad district.

Work Profile

In Aurangpur village out of total population, 86 were engaged in work activities. 91.86 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 8.14 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 86 workers engaged in Main Work, 78 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 0 were Agricultural labourer.
